Transaction 3a7d5987212231d99d5d9564458d76a41e267a4bb22ea3580b5fdfba5ec7bf6e
1 Input
1 Output
-
3a7d5987212231d99d5d9564458d76a41e267a4bb22ea3580b5fdfba5ec7bf6e:0
- value
- 4008790
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5d3b6f2437ef0a5550b60f1717dac4cc4a0a4f9
- address
- bc1q6hfmdujr0mc224gtvrchzldvfnz2pf8ewemuqu